Abstract

A method for generating a dialogue event in a natural language processing system comprises loading, into a computer memory, a computer-readable seed command describing an ordered sequence of two or more top-level dialogue events. A dialogue event includes a client utterance or a computerized assistant response. The seed command includes one or more sub-commands, each sub-command corresponding to a portion of the ordered sequence of two or more top-level dialogue events, and the focal sub-command of the one or more sub-commands being parametrized by a seed semantic parameter. The method further comprises re-parametrizing the focal sub-command by outputting a plurality of different re-parametrized focal sub-commands wherein, in each re-parametrized focal sub-command, the seed semantic parameter is replaced by one of a plurality of different synthetic semantic parameters. The method further comprises, for each of the plurality of different synthetic semantic parameters: saving a corresponding re-parametrized focal sub-command.
